ALASKA FROM ABOVE
RICHARD THOMPSON III
AERIAL SURVEY, 2007 - 2009
Strange biology in northern latitude creates striking graphic contrast, seen here as organic but unfamiliar patterns through different layers of the Alaskan landscape. Photographs made in infrared and color between 300 and 2000 feet from surface.
